Z is for Zucchini

 

Yeah, what did you expect? Zucchini is a favorite summer squash of mine.

Zucchini is a versatile, nutrient-rich vegetable that's typically green, cylindrical, and has a mild flavor, though yellow varieties exist. It's easily cooked by roasting, sautéing, or grilling, often paired with yellow summer squash, and is best when chosen small to medium-sized for optimal flavor and texture.

I often add cooked zucchini and yellow squash to my pasta sauce, to make it a chunkier sauce. Zucchini is delicious cooked plain, with onion, garlic salt and seasonings. It's such a versatile vegetable, without much flavor, so it can be made into a savory or a sweet dish.
